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ions: ReCaptcha Integration for WordPress plugin versions 1.2.5 and earlier
Description: The issue is related to Reflected Cross-Site Scripting due to the use of add query arg without proper escaping on the URL. This allows unauthenticated attackers to inject arbitrary web scripts in pages that execute if they can successfully trick a user into performing an action such as clicking on a link.
Recommendations: For versions 1.2.5 and earlier, update to a version later than 1.2.5 to resolve the issue. As a temporary workaround, consider restricting access to the plugin's functionality until a patch is available. Avoid using the add query arg function without proper escaping on the URL in the affected plugin.
